Transaction 4eeceda8eb5d9d3da99123f161f7b6101ea2541a531991aeda92413fd6e84144

16 Input
2 Outputs
  • 4eeceda8eb5d9d3da99123f161f7b6101ea2541a531991aeda92413fd6e84144:0
  • value  1000014
    address  19DYkMdiCyMDLDvxVmvRehkup3vVctTHVk
  • 4eeceda8eb5d9d3da99123f161f7b6101ea2541a531991aeda92413fd6e84144:1
  • value  2571025
    address  3F8msjW9Tp28DrKJ8vrcccAh9TWeq89K5T